/ | Leave a Comment

APOLOGIZING: S’EXCUSER: To make/give/find an excuse. Faire/donner/trouver une excuse. Don’t make excuses. Ne trouvez pas d’excuses. There’s no excuse. Il n’y a pas d’excuse. You will be sorry – you’ll regret it. Tu le regretteras. To make up a good excuse. Inventer une bonne excuse. Plausible/silly excuses. Des excuses plausibles/ farfelues. Under the pretext that… […]

Read more »